Biography

I have received my PhD in Life Engineering from Universite de Lyon(France) in 2017. And From 2018 to 2019, I have worked in Chungnam National University located at South Korea. After awarded Marie Curie fellowship, I have also worked in the University College Dublin during 2019-2022. Additionally, I am the senior scientist working in the LumiraDx during 2022-2023, before joining the Turku University.

Research

I am interested in the electrochemical biosensor and point of care assay, in terms of healthcare diagnostic area. Based on my multi-discipline background, my research is aiming at investigating the magnetic nanoparticle, magnetophoresis and electroanalysis etc, to advance the biosensing and Point of care assay.
